How did the plebeians gain the right to vote and hold political office in the Roman Republic?

I agree with the person above - the way that the plebeians gained the right to vote and hold political office in the Roman Republic is by threatening to leave Rome and build a new city. 
Since that was not an option, they were allowed some rights.

Which of the following is the theory that a nation can become strong by building up its gold supply and expanding its trade?
Leto [7]

Answer:

Your answer should be B: mercantilism

Explanation:

According to the theory of mercantilism, a nation could increase its wealth and power in two ways. First, it could obtain as much gold and silver as possible. Second, it could establish a favorable balance of trade, in which it sold more goods than it bought. Hope this helped :)
